Cuban drug approved to treat COVID-19 in India

India’s Drug Regulatory Authority has approved exceptional use of the Cuban drug Itolizumab to treat severe patients with COVID-19, reported Eduardo Ojito Magaz, director of Cuba’s Molecular Immunology Center (CIM), on Twitter. Winner of a National Prize from the Cuban Academy of Sciences in 2014, this humanized monoclonal antibody has been part of the medical care protocol for COVID-19 in Cuba since April.

Using waste from rice processing to generate energy

Cuban experts, with advice from India, have set up a plant that will allow the use of rice husks to generate electricity. The work is being carried out at the Enrique Troncoso mill, the largest in the province, affiliated with the Los Palacios Agroindustrial Enterprise, where this new technology will make it possible to save more than 200 tons of diesel a year.

Chinese President Meets India”s Prime Minister

Chinese President Xi Jinping wished today a happy stay to India”s Prime Minister Narendra Modi, in his home province of Shaanxi, where he was welcomed with honors in an unusual gesture of the local protocol. The Chinese leader said this is the first time that he has received a foreign statesman in his birthplace, after welcoming Modi in the ancient city of Xi’an.
